Avamar: Unable to edit DD in the AUI if the 'Use certificate authentication for REST communication' is selected

Sommaire: If the 'Use certificate authentication for REST communication' checkbox is selected, a Data Domain cannot be edited from the Avamar AUI.

Symptômes

While attempting to "Validate" when editing a Data Domain within the Avamar Web User Interface (AUI), the following error occurs:

Failed to get Data Domain system information.
Please check DDBoost credential is correct and Avamar generated public key is imported to DataDomain system if needed.
 

For example:

Error received when editing a DD

 

Note: This issue is only seen in the AUI, not the Java UI.

Cause

This occurs if Avamar Security Session is disabled and the checkbox next to "Use certificate authentication for REST communication" (shown below) is selected:

AUI - Data Domain edit

 

This feature is only supported when Avamar Session Security features are enabled.

If Avamar Session Security is disabled, the error is received.

Résolution

1.Verify the current Session Security Session settings:

a. Log in to the Avamar Utility Node as admin.

b. Elevate to root privilege.

c. Run the following command:

enable_secure_config.sh --showconfig 
 

If Session Security is disabled, the output is similar to the following:

Current Session Security Settings
----------------------------------
"encrypt_server_authenticate"                           ="false"
"secure_agent_feature_on"                               ="false"
"session_ticket_feature_on"                             ="false"
"secure_agents_mode"                                    ="unsecure_only"
"secure_st_mode"                                        ="unsecure_only"
"secure_dd_feature_on"                                  ="false"
"verifypeer"                                            ="no"

Client and Server Communication set to Default (Workflow Re-Run) mode with No Authentication.
Client Agent and Management Server Communication set to unsecure_only mode.
Secure Data Domain Feature is Disabled.
 

If Session Security is enabled, the output is similar to the following:

Current Session Security Settings
----------------------------------
"encrypt_server_authenticate"                           ="true"
"secure_agent_feature_on"                               ="true"
"session_ticket_feature_on"                             ="true"
"secure_agents_mode"                                    ="mixed"
"secure_st_mode"                                        ="mixed"
"secure_dd_feature_on"                                  ="true"
"verifypeer"                                            ="no"
 

2. If Session Security is disabled, clear the 'Use certificate authentication for REST communication' checkbox in the AUI and retry the required activity.

If Session Security is already enabled, the error should not be received.
